Abstract

The invention relates to a process for the manufacture of epichlorohydrin (“ECH”) by catalytic oxidation of allyl chloride (“AC”) with an oxidant wherein the catalytic oxidation is performed in an aqueous reaction medium, wherein a water-soluble manganese complex is used as oxidation catalyst, followed by the isolation of epichlorohydrin.

Claims (28)

1. A process for the manufacture of epichlorohydrin, comprising:

reacting allyl chloride with an hydrogen peroxide in the presence of a catalyst in an aqueous reaction medium in a system having one or two organic phases, wherein the catalyst comprises a water-soluble manganese complex and the molar ratio of allyl chloride to hydrogen peroxide is from 1:0.1 to 1:1; and

isolating an epichlorohydrin product in the one or two organic phases, and wherein the water-soluble manganese complex is selected from a mononuclear manganese complex of the formula (I):

[LMnX 3 ]Y  (I)

or a binuclear manganese complex of the formula (II):

[LMn(μ-X) 3 MnL]Y 2   (II)

wherein Mn is a manganese atom; L or each L independently is a polydentate ligand of triazacyclononane or a substituted triazacyclononane; each X independently is a coordinating species selected from the group consisting of: RO − , Cl − , Br − , I − , F − , NCS − , N 3 − , I 3 − , NH 3 , NR 3 , RCOO − , RSO 3 − , RSO 4 − , OH − , O 2− , O 2 2− , HOO − , H 2 O, SH − , CN − , OCN − , and S 4 2− and combinations thereof, wherein R is a C 1 -C 20 radical selected from the group consisting of alkyl, cycloalkyl, aryl, benzyl and combinations thereof and each μ-X independently is a bridging coordinating species selected from the group consisting of: RO − , Cl − , Br − , I − , F − , NCS − , N 3 − , I 3 − , NH 3 , NR 3 , RCOO − , RSO 3 − , RSO 4 − , OH − , O 2− , O 2 2− , HOO − , H 2 O, SH − , CN − , OCN − , and S 4 2− and combinations thereof, wherein R is a C 1 -C 20 radical selected from the group consisting of alkyl, cycloalkyl, aryl, benzyl and combinations thereof, and Y is an anion counterion selected from the group consisting of RO − , Cl − , Br − , I − , F − , SO 4 2− , RCOO − , PF 6 − , acetate, tosylate, triflate (CF 3 SO 3 − ) and a combination thereof, wherein R is a C 1 -C 20 radical selected from the group consisting of alkyl, cycloalkyl, aryl, benzyl and combinations thereof, wherein the aqueous reaction medium further comprises a buffer system so as to stabilize the pH and a pH in the range of from 3 to 6.5.

2. The process of claim 1 , wherein the one or two organic phases comprise epichlorohydrin product or a mixture of allyl chloride and epichlorohydrin product.

3. The process of claim 1 , wherein the manganese complex comprises the formula [LMn(μ-X) 3 MnL]Y 2 , wherein Mn is a manganese atom; L is a L is a triazacyclononane or substituted triazacyclononane; each X independently is a coordinating species: and each μ-X independently is a bridging coordinating species, selected from the group consisting of: RO − , Cl − , Br − , F − , NCS − , N 3 − , I 3 − , NH 3 , NR 3 , RCOO − , RSO 3 − , RSO 4 − , OH − , O 2− , HOO − , H 2 O, SH − , CN − , OCN − , and S4 2− and combinations thereof, wherein R is a C 1 -C 20 radical selected from the group consisting of alkyl, cycloalkyl, aryl, benzyl and combinations thereof, and Y is SO 4 2− , PF 6 − , acetate, or a combination thereof.

4. The process of claim 1 , further comprising agitating the aqueous reaction medium and the one or two organic phases.

5. The process of claim 4 , wherein the stirring the aqueous reaction medium comprises stirring the system with a stirrer at between 100 rpms and 650 rpm.

6. The process of claim 1 , wherein the aqueous reaction medium further comprises a buffer system at a buffer to catalyst ratio from 10:1 to 100:1.

7. The process of claim 6 , wherein the buffer system comprises an acid-salt combination.

8. The process of claim 7 , wherein the acid-salt combination comprises oxalic acid-oxalate salt or acetic acid-acetate salt.

9. The process of claim 1 , wherein the catalyst is present in a concentration from 0.001 mmol/L to 10 mmol/L.

10. The process of claim 1 , wherein the catalyst is used in a molar ratio of the catalyst (Mn) to the allyl chloride from 1:10 to 1:10,000,000.

11. The process of claim 1 , wherein the aqueous reaction comprises a pH in the range of from 3 to 6.5.

12. The process of claim 1 , wherein the aqueous reaction comprises a pH in the range of from 3 to 4.2.

13. The process of claim 1 , wherein the allyl chloride and the hydrogen peroxide are reacted at a molar ratio of the allyl chloride to the hydrogen peroxide in the range from 1:0.2 to 1:0.8.

14. The process of claim 1 , wherein the reaction is performed in a batch process, in a continuous process or in a semi-continuous process.

15. The process of claim 1 , wherein the aqueous reaction medium comprises a 100% aqueous medium excluding any dissolved epoxide and allyl chloride.

16. The process of claim 1 , wherein the manganese complex comprises the formula [LMn(μ-X) 3 MnL]Y 2 , wherein L is a triazacyclononane or substituted triazacyclononane and the counterion Y is PF 6 − or CH 3 CO 2 − .

17. The process of claim 1 , wherein the catalyst comprises

a binuclear manganese complex of the general formula (II):

[LMn(μ-X) 3 MnL]Y 2   (II),

wherein Mn is a manganese; L or each L independently is a polydentate ligand of triazacyclononane or a substituted triazacyclononane; each μ-X independently is a bridging coordinating species of: O 2− , RCOO − , RSO 3 − , RSO 4 − , wherein R is selected from the group consisting of C 1 -C 20 alkyl, C 1 -C 20 cycloalkyl, C 1 -C 20 aryl, benzyl and combinations thereof, and Y is an anion selected from the group consisting of SO 4 2− , PF 6 − , acetate, and a combination thereof;

wherein the aqueous reaction medium further comprises a buffer system with a pH range from 3 to 4.2; and

wherein the molar ratio of the terminal olefin to the hydrogen peroxide in the range of from 1:0.1 to 1.2:1.
